CADENA-CHALA, Martha Cecilia  y  ORCASITAS-GARCIA, José Ramón. Learning Communities in the Basque Country: School Characterization and Organization. educ.educ. [online]. 2016, vol.19, n.3, pp.373-391. ISSN 0123-1294.  https://doi.org/10.5294/edu.2016.19.3.4.

Learning communities have revealed themselves as an approach to school organization that encourages academic success and the improvement of co-existence among students. The experience is focused on the community's participative education, which is established in all its surroundings. It also focuses on structures such as: Relation-Interaction: community education. Classroom: construction as a group. Institution: organization and opening to participation, a network with the educational system, educational area and policies. Qualitative-descriptive research with a socio-critical approach.

Palabras clave : Learning Communities; School Organization; Curriculum Development; Socio-Critical Pedagogy; Basque Country.
